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17235155140 610383 564 086203183 389614
7846634 0583880307
7846634 0583880307
81289964 268 6089745
All about undefined
Interested in learning more?
7846634 0583880307
81289964 268 6089745
See more
33392117424 08031865794
22588382856 87822236 44431245880 376167 6990
See more
17 438382547 087841
84108 81 570638
See more